Help Please

I had my sleeve surgery on January 7, 2915. During the liquid/soft food weeks I lost weight. Last week I started eating food food and I realize I don't feel full and can still eat A LOT. I feel like maybe they didn't really do the sleeve.

I know I have to work at losing weight but I was hoping the sleeve would make it easier.

Has this happened to anyone else?

I had the same feeling a few weeks out and my doc told me that hunger is often thirst in disguise. Between meals, try filling your sleeve with fluids. That really helps curb the hunger. And lots of fluids are good for everything, including avoiding constipation and maintaining skin elasticity. But remember not to drink anything for 30-45 minutes before or after meals. Good luck!
